Understanding Kundalini Energy
Kundalini is derived from the Sanskrit word "kundal," which means "coiled." This energy is often visualized as a coiled serpent lying at the base of the spine. When awakened, Kundalini rises through the chakras, leading to heightened awareness, spiritual enlightenment, and a deeper connection to the universe.
The Chakras and Kundalini
The human body has seven primary chakras, each corresponding to different aspects of our physical, emotional, and spiritual well-being. These chakras are:
Root Chakra (Muladhara): Located at the base of the spine, it represents stability and security.
Sacral Chakra (Svadhisthana): Found in the lower abdomen, it governs creativity and sexuality.
Solar Plexus Chakra (Manipura): Located in the upper abdomen, it is associated with personal power and confidence.
Heart Chakra (Anahata): Situated in the center of the chest, it symbolizes love and compassion.
Throat Chakra (Vishuddha): Found in the throat, it relates to communication and self-expression.
Third Eye Chakra (Ajna): Located between the eyebrows, it represents intuition and insight.
Crown Chakra (Sahasrara): At the top of the head, it signifies spiritual connection and enlightenment.
When Kundalini energy rises through these chakras, it can lead to transformative experiences, including increased creativity, emotional healing, and spiritual awakening.

How to Unlock Kundalini Energy
Unlocking Kundalini is not a one-size-fits-all process. It requires dedication, practice, and a willingness to explore the depths of your being. Here are some effective methods to awaken this powerful energy:
1. Kundalini Yoga
Kundalini yoga combines physical postures, breath control, meditation, and chanting to awaken the Kundalini energy. This practice is designed to stimulate the chakras and promote the flow of energy throughout the body.
Key Components of Kundalini Yoga:
Asanas (Postures): Specific poses that help open the chakras and release energy.
Pranayama (Breath Control): Techniques that regulate breath to enhance energy flow.
Meditation: Focused practices that promote mindfulness and self-awareness.
Mantras: Repetitive sounds or phrases that help align the mind and spirit.
2. Meditation
Meditation is a powerful tool for awakening Kundalini. By quieting the mind and focusing inward, you can create a conducive environment for the energy to rise.
Tips for Effective Meditation:
Find a Quiet Space: Choose a serene environment free from distractions.
Set an Intention: Clearly define your purpose for meditating.
Focus on Your Breath: Use your breath as an anchor to maintain focus.
Visualize the Energy: Imagine the Kundalini energy rising through your chakras.
3. Breathwork
Breathwork techniques, such as Kapalabhati (skull shining breath) and Nadi Shodhana (alternate nostril breathing), can help activate Kundalini energy. These practices enhance oxygen flow and stimulate the nervous system, promoting energy movement.
4. Chanting Mantras
Chanting specific mantras can help raise your vibrational frequency and connect you to the Kundalini energy. The mantra "Sat Nam," meaning "truth is my identity," is commonly used in Kundalini practices.
